Australian Sets World Record Sinking 135 Yard Putt

I was watching highlights on the Golf Channel and one of the stories was about a new Guinness record for the longest made putt. I went to Google to find out more and found an article about a group of Youtube stars called “How Ridiculous” had set the record.

Australian YouTube stars How Ridiculous have made a name for themselves with their incredible basketball trick shots, but the guys have taken to fairways for their latest sporting feat after managing to set a new world record for the Longest golf putt-non-tournament.
Team member Brett Stanford managed the historical shot at the 5th hole at the Point Walter Golf Course, Western Australia earlier this month.
The record setting putt was measured at 135.67 yards.  I guess in this case, it was “putt for show”.

Dustin Johnson Wins L.A. Open

Dustin Johnson easily won the Genesis Open in L.A. played on Riviera Golf Club. Johnson ran out to a big lead after a third-round 64, and then cruised to the clubhouse in the final round for a 5-shot win over Thomas Pieters and Scott Brown.  At one point he lead by as many as 8 shots in the final round.

With the win, Johnson has now won at least one event in each of his first 12 seasons on tour, and also moved up to the top spot in the Official World Golf Rankings. Johnson also climbed up to the 4th position in our Power Rankings.

Jordan Spieth Wins Pebble Beach Pro-Am

Jordan Spieth cruised to an easy 4-shot win over Kelly Kraft at the AT&T Pebble Beach Pro-Am. This was Spieth’s ninth tour win, making him only the second person to win 9-times before the age of 24 (Tiger is the other).

Nike to Introduce Air Jordan Golf Shoes

Golf.com reports that Nike is introducing a golf version of the Air Jordan I.

Nike sneakerheads rejoice: you will soon be able to wear the iconic Air Jordan I on the golf course. Starting Friday, Nike will roll out red, black and white and white and silver versions of the Air Jordan I in a special golf edition on Nike.com and at select retailers.

The shoe will be waterproof and the sole will have soft-spikes, so these will not be good for going from playing partners on the links to two-on-two on the courts.

Matsuyama Defends Title at Phoenix Open

Hideki Matsuyama won on the 4th playoff hole to edge out Webb Simpson and defend his title at the Waste Management Phoenix Open. Matsuyama and Simpson had tied in regulation at 17-under par.
